Does the 1992 Ford Taurus have power train:automatic transmission problems?
Power Train:automatic Transmission is the #2 most-reported problem area on the 1992 Ford Taurus: 74 of 681 complaints on file (10.9%). Complaints are unverified owner reports, not confirmed defects.
How many complaints does the 1992 Ford Taurus have in total?
681 complaints were on file with NHTSA as of 07/12/2026. Across all categories, 52 involved a crash, 21 involved a fire, 49 reported injuries, and 2 reported deaths.
